Who is Rhian Ramos?
Rhian Denise Ramos Howell was born on October 3, 1990, in Makati City, Metro Manila, to a British father, Gareth Howell, and a Filipino mother, Clara Ramos. This multicultural background has shaped her international appeal and diverse skillset. She is a versatile Filipino-British actress, commercial model, singer, television host, and professional race car driver with a 20-year career in Philippine entertainment, marked by critical acclaim, multiple award nominations, and significant recognition for her antagonist and lead roles across television and film.
As a passionate multidisciplinary performer, Rhian has successfully navigated the evolving Philippine entertainment landscape, transitioning from supporting roles to complex antagonist characters to major lead roles in prestige television productions. Her cousin, Ida Henares, served as an executive at GMA Network, providing industry connections that helped establish her presence with the network. Beyond entertainment, Rhian is an accomplished race car driver and has been recognized by FHM magazine’s “100 Sexiest Women in the World” list five consecutive years (2007–2011).
Early Career & Breakthrough (2006–2009)
Rhian Ramos began her entertainment career in 2006 with television commercials and guest appearances, initially working as a commercial model. Her television debut came with the fantasy-drama series Captain Barbell, where she played lead role Leah Lazaro. In 2007, she made her film debut in The Promise, for which she won the Golden Screen Award for Breakthrough Performance by an Actress—establishing her as a talented newcomer in Philippine cinema. That same year, she appeared in the psychological thriller Ouija (Seance) and established herself through TV work in Lupin and guest appearances in anthology series.
By 2008–2009, Rhian had expanded her television portfolio with roles in LaLola (2008), I.T.A.L.Y. (2008), and Stairway to Heaven (2009), appearing opposite international star Kim Tae-hee. She also released her debut dance-music album, Audition Dance Battle, under Universal Records in 2009, demonstrating her musical capabilities. Additionally, she hosted Pinoy Idol Extra (2008), beginning her work as a television personality.

Established Star & Antagonist Roles (2015–2020)
In 2015, Rhian achieved a major career milestone with a lead role in the television series The Rich Man’s Daughter, playing the complex female lead. She also appeared in the acclaimed film Silong (2015). This period marked her transition to more substantial and complex roles, where she began to establish herself as an actress capable of handling antagonist and morally ambiguous characters. She continued to appear in major television productions for GMA Network, expanding her range and demonstrating her versatility across different genres and character types.
Prestige Television Era (2020–2026)
In 2023, Rhian secured the lead role of Margaret Royales-Castor in the prime-time drama series Royal Blood, a prestige production that showcased her ability to carry a major television drama. In 2024, she appeared as Filipina Dela Cruz in In the Arms of the Conqueror, and continued with significant television work. Most notably, in 2025, she starred as Kera Mitena, the main antagonist, in Encantadia Chronicles: Sang’gre—a highly anticipated continuation of the beloved Encantadia fantasy franchise. This role as a complex, powerful antagonist has become one of her signature performances. Additionally, she has taken on hosting duties for major shows, including Where in Manila (2025) and Bubble Gang (2025–2026), maintaining her presence across multiple entertainment platforms.
